We Beat Beethoven!

Dean, Erika, and Braden all ran in the "Beat Beethoven" 5k . The goal here was to complete the 5k (3.1 miles) in less time that it takes for Beethoven's 5th Symphony, which is about 32 minutes. So they started up the music, and away we went. There was somebody there dressed up as Beethoven, to set the pace, so as long as you were ahead of him at the finish line, you would receive a pin saying "I beat Beethoven". Each of us had our personal bests in this race, I guess there is something about a tall weird man in a freaky white wig that thinks he is Beethoven running behind you that motivates you to run faster than you normally would! It was Braden's personal best because it was his first official race, and because he ran fast. Each of us placed in our age divisions. Dean took second in men ages 40-49, and 7th overall, finishing in 22:30 minutes, Erika placed 3rd in women 40-49, and 18th overall with her time of 26:29, and Braden place 3rd in men 20-29, and 13th overall with a 23:30 time. Oh and we all beat Beethoven with more than 5+ minutes to spare!
